Motion · S3M-07589 · 13 Dec 2010

The Historic Reopening of the Airdrie to Bathgate Rail Link

Lodged by Mary Mulligan Standard Motion 20 supporters

The motion

That the Parliament warmly welcomes the completion of the Airdrie to Bathgate rail link, the longest passenger route to be opened in Scotland for more than 100 years; commends the efforts of all involved in this project, in particular Network Rail, for delivering the project on time and on budget and the previous administration for what it considers was its vision; further notes what it believes will be the significant economic, environmental and social benefits that the line will bring for communities along the route in wider West Lothian, North Lanarkshire and across Scotland, and praises the local communities along the route for what it considers was their patience during the construction of the new line.
